Project Description and Background

Aim

Throughout this experiment there will be a number of different aims that will ideally be covered.

a) To measure the horizontal distance (lengths) of traverse legs using pacing, surveyor's tape and total station

b) To measure vertical distances (elevation) of transverse stations K using an automatic level

c) To measure the coordinates of points B and C using total station (where coordinates

of are provided) and to take a number of measurements covering the whole area (side of library building, concrete footpaths, tree and any other important features) that help to prepare a topographical map of the survey area.

Also use total station to measure a number of quantities specified in the total station field notes

d) To familiarise with the use of GPS to measure coordinates and other computations (i.e. Slope and horizontal distances, area, perimeters etc.)
